Career Path

In the Shelter Response: Operations Management sector, various key roles significantly contribute to the UK's emergency preparedness and response. This section highlights relevant job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and through a 3D Pie chart. Check out the following roles and their respective percentages in the industry: 1. **Disaster Response Manager** (25%) These professionals manage disaster response teams, resources, and communication efforts to ensure swift and effective recovery. 2. **Emergency Shelter Coordinator** (20%) Shelter coordinators oversee temporary accommodation facilities, providing care, support, and essential resources to affected individuals. 3. **Housing Specialist** (18%) Housing specialists develop and implement strategies for long-term housing solutions, ensuring the well-being of those displaced due to disasters. 4. **Logistics Coordinator** (15%) Logistics coordinators manage the transportation and distribution of relief supplies, streamlining the allocation process. 5. **Case Manager** (12%) Case managers offer guidance and support to disaster survivors, addressing their immediate needs and assisting in the recovery process. 6. **Volunteer Coordinator** (10%) Volunteer coordinators recruit, train, and manage volunteers, ensuring a well-organized and dedicated workforce during emergency situations.
